How a Centrifuge Separates Oil Sludge
A high-speed industrial centrifuge uses centrifugal force to split oil sludge into three layers:
-
Recovered Oil (light phase) – Recycled back into production
-
Water (middle phase) – Treated or discharged
-
Solid Residue (heavy phase) – Safe disposal or further processing
Key Components:
-
Rotating Bowl: Spins at 3,000-5,000 RPM for effective separation
-
Scroll Conveyor: Continuously discharges solids
-
Adjustable Weirs: Fine-tune separation efficiency

FAQs About Oil Sludge Centrifuges
Q: How much oil can I recover from tank bottom sludge?
A: Typically 30-60% of sludge volume, depending on viscosity and age.
Q: What maintenance does a sludge centrifuge need?
A: Daily inspections, monthly bearing lubrication, and annual bowl refurbishment.
Q: Can it handle emulsified oil?
A: Yes, with pre-treatment chemicals or 3-phase separation models.
